Subject: [PATCH v1 4/4] hw/arm: versal: Connect the CRL

Connect the CRL (Clock Reset LPD) to the Versal SoC.

Signed-off-by: Edgar E. Iglesias <edgar.iglesias@amd.com>
---
 hw/arm/xlnx-versal.c         | 54 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++--
 include/hw/arm/xlnx-versal.h |  4 +++
 2 files changed, 56 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/hw/arm/xlnx-versal.c b/hw/arm/xlnx-versal.c
index ebad8dbb6d..57276e1506 100644
--- a/hw/arm/xlnx-versal.c
+++ b/hw/arm/xlnx-versal.c
@@ -539,6 +539,57 @@ static void versal_create_ospi(Versal *s, qemu_irq *pic)
     qdev_connect_gpio_out(orgate, 0, pic[VERSAL_OSPI_IRQ]);
 }
 
+static void versal_create_crl(Versal *s, qemu_irq *pic)
+{
+    SysBusDevice *sbd;
+    int i;
+
+    object_initialize_child(OBJECT(s), "crl", &s->lpd.crl,
+                            TYPE_XLNX_VERSAL_CRL);
+    sbd = SYS_BUS_DEVICE(&s->lpd.crl);
+
+    for (i = 0; i < ARRAY_SIZE(s->lpd.rpu.cpu); i++) {
+        g_autofree gchar *name = g_strdup_printf("cpu_r5[%d]", i);
+
+        object_property_set_link(OBJECT(&s->lpd.crl),
+                                 name, OBJECT(&s->lpd.rpu.cpu[i]),
+                                 &error_abort);
+    }
+
+    for (i = 0; i < ARRAY_SIZE(s->lpd.iou.gem); i++) {
+        g_autofree gchar *name = g_strdup_printf("gem[%d]", i);
+
+        object_property_set_link(OBJECT(&s->lpd.crl),
+                                 name, OBJECT(&s->lpd.iou.gem[i]),
+                                 &error_abort);
+    }
+
+    for (i = 0; i < ARRAY_SIZE(s->lpd.iou.adma); i++) {
+        g_autofree gchar *name = g_strdup_printf("adma[%d]", i);
+
+        object_property_set_link(OBJECT(&s->lpd.crl),
+                                 name, OBJECT(&s->lpd.iou.adma[i]),
+                                 &error_abort);
+    }
+
+    for (i = 0; i < ARRAY_SIZE(s->lpd.iou.uart); i++) {
+        g_autofree gchar *name = g_strdup_printf("uart[%d]", i);
+
+        object_property_set_link(OBJECT(&s->lpd.crl),
+                                 name, OBJECT(&s->lpd.iou.uart[i]),
+                                 &error_abort);
+    }
+
+    object_property_set_link(OBJECT(&s->lpd.crl),
+                             "usb", OBJECT(&s->lpd.iou.usb),
+                             &error_abort);
+
+    sysbus_realize(sbd, &error_fatal);
+    memory_region_add_subregion(&s->mr_ps, MM_CRL,
+                                sysbus_mmio_get_region(sbd, 0));
+    sysbus_connect_irq(sbd, 0, pic[VERSAL_CRL_IRQ]);
+}
+
 /* This takes the board allocated linear DDR memory and creates aliases
  * for each split DDR range/aperture on the Versal address map.
  */
@@ -622,8 +673,6 @@ static void versal_unimp(Versal *s)
 
     versal_unimp_area(s, "psm", &s->mr_ps,
                         MM_PSM_START, MM_PSM_END - MM_PSM_START);
-    versal_unimp_area(s, "crl", &s->mr_ps,
-                        MM_CRL, MM_CRL_SIZE);
     versal_unimp_area(s, "crf", &s->mr_ps,
                         MM_FPD_CRF, MM_FPD_CRF_SIZE);
     versal_unimp_area(s, "apu", &s->mr_ps,
@@ -681,6 +730,7 @@ static void versal_realize(DeviceState *dev, Error **errp)
     versal_create_efuse(s, pic);
     versal_create_pmc_iou_slcr(s, pic);
     versal_create_ospi(s, pic);
+    versal_create_crl(s, pic);
     versal_map_ddr(s);
     versal_unimp(s);
 
diff --git a/include/hw/arm/xlnx-versal.h b/include/hw/arm/xlnx-versal.h
index 155e8c4b8c..cbe8a19c10 100644
--- a/include/hw/arm/xlnx-versal.h
+++ b/include/hw/arm/xlnx-versal.h
@@ -29,6 +29,7 @@
 #include "hw/nvram/xlnx-versal-efuse.h"
 #include "hw/ssi/xlnx-versal-ospi.h"
 #include "hw/dma/xlnx_csu_dma.h"
+#include "hw/misc/xlnx-versal-crl.h"
 #include "hw/misc/xlnx-versal-pmc-iou-slcr.h"
 
 #define TYPE_XLNX_VERSAL "xlnx-versal"
@@ -87,6 +88,8 @@ struct Versal {
             qemu_or_irq irq_orgate;
             XlnxXramCtrl ctrl[XLNX_VERSAL_NR_XRAM];
         } xram;
+
+        XlnxVersalCRL crl;
     } lpd;
 
     /* The Platform Management Controller subsystem.  */
@@ -127,6 +130,7 @@ struct Versal {
 #define VERSAL_TIMER_NS_EL1_IRQ     14
 #define VERSAL_TIMER_NS_EL2_IRQ     10
 
+#define VERSAL_CRL_IRQ             10
 #define VERSAL_UART0_IRQ_0         18
 #define VERSAL_UART1_IRQ_0         19
 #define VERSAL_USB0_IRQ_0          22
